Apologies for the delay in responding. Unfortunately, having cured this problem by using my Gutsy xorg.conf I no longer have the original and I am not in a position to attempt to reinstall Hardy. However, I have recently hit a similar problem with Intrepid on the same machine.
After a clean install of Intrepid I had the following xorg.conf: ----------------------------------------------- Section "Device" Identifier "Configured Video Device" EndSection Section "Monitor" Identifier "Configured Monitor" EndSection Section "Screen" Identifier "Default Screen" Monitor "Configured Monitor" Device "Configured Video Device" EndSection ---------------------------------------------- The monitor is a 1600x1200 LCD panel connected via DVI. xrandr offers the following resolutions: Screen 0: minimum 320 x 200, current 1152 x 864, maximum 1360 x 1360 VGA disconnected (normal left inverted right x axis y axis) TMDS-1 connected 1152x864+0+0 (normal left inverted right x axis y axis) 0mm x 0mm 1360x768 59.8 1152x864 60.0* 1024x768 60.0 800x600 60.3 640x480 59.9 The same system using Hardy offers: Screen 0: minimum 640 x 480, current 1600 x 1200, maximum 1600 x 1200 default connected 1600x1200+0+0 (normal left inverted right) 0mm x 0mm 1600x1200 60.0* 1280x1024 75.0 1024x768 75.0 800x600 75.0 640x480 75.0 I have attached a zip file with my hardy and intrepid xorg.conf files plus the Xorg.0.log from intrepid.
